gpt4 book ai didi

java - Spark SQL - 选择所有和计算列?

转载 作者:搜寻专家 更新时间:2023-10-31 08:16:33 24 4
gpt4 key购买 nike

这是一个完全菜鸟的问题,很抱歉。在 Spark 中,我可以使用 select as:

df.select("*"); //to select everything
df.select(df.col("colname")[, df.col("colname")]); //to select one or more columns
df.select(df.col("colname"), df.col("colname").plus(1)) //to select a column and a calculated column

但是。如何选择所有列加上计算的列?明显地select("*", df.col("colname").plus(1)) 不起作用(编译错误)。这在JAVA下怎么实现呢?谢谢!

最佳答案

只是做:

df.select(df.col("*"), df.col("colName").plus(1));

关于java - Spark SQL - 选择所有和计算列?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/38467763/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com